Triton ULTRA Smart Security is a modern vape detector that does not rely on only videos or audio recordings. This ensures 100% protection from privacy while delivering real-time intelligence. The device makes use of advanced particulate sensor technology to analyze the air in near-real time. If vape aerosols (like perfumes with strong scents), cigarette smoke or marijuana vapors appear the device will send an instant notification via text email or text message to designated employees. False positives remain exceptionally low, allowing administrators to be confident that each alert needs immediate attention.

One unit is able to cover the entire bathroom, locker or hallway, making the deployment of this device cost-effective. Triton customers usually report a drop in vaping within five weeks. Why is this? Data-driven deterrence. The Triton Cloud Dashboard will reveal “hotspots” where vaping happens most frequently and at what times, allowing principals to redirect hall monitors or security personnel precisely to the areas they’re required.
Beyond Detection, Occupancy Visibility and Loitering control
What sets Triton apart from basic vape detectors is its patent-pending occupancy visualization technology. The ULTRA sensor does not need images or sounds to track dwell time or count of people in areas that are sensitive. Administrators are able to view heat maps colored by color that show when bathrooms become social hubs that are prime to smoke and also the prolonged close contact that spreads respiratory illnesses.
